SIALKOT:


Two women were murdered allegedly by their husbands in separate incidents in Narowal on Wednesday.


Police said Basharat Ali is accused of strangling his wife Nasreen Bibi in Ghaziwal village. Police said that Ali had fled after killing his wife and they were looking for him.

They said her body had been handed over to her family after autopsy. Separately, a woman was found dead hanging from a ceiling fan in her room in Bouaa-Shah Gharib village.

Her parents told police that her husband Mudassar had murdered her over a domestic spat.

Police said they had registered a case against Mudassar and his family members.
